Communication in a Virtual Organization (Managerial Communication Series, 3)

Abstract: STUDENTS AND NEW MANAGERS interested in the complexities of managing work relationships through electronically mediated communication will find this book an easy read. Its 109 pages blend theory, knowledge, and practice from three different disciplines (management, technical writing, and communication). Collins urges readers to confront directly how new technologies have changed where and how we work.
